RESOLUTION NO. 862
A RESOLUTION OF TH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F
ROLLING HILLS ADOPTING THE FY 1999-00 CITY OF
ROLLING HILLS BUDGET INCLUDING THE ANNUAL
REPORT ON: GENERAL FUND, COMMUNITY FACILITIES
FUND, MUNICIPAL SELF INSURANCE FUND, REFUSE
COLLECTION FUND, SOLID WASTE CHARGES, COPS FUND,
TRAFFIC SAFETY FUND, TRANSIT FUND -PROP. A, AND
TRANSIT FUND -PROP. C FOR FISCAL YEAR 1999-00.
WHEREAS, members of the Rolling Hills City Council opened a public
hearing on Monday, June 14, 1999 to consider the recommended Fiscal Year 1999-00 City of
Rolling Hills Draft Budget; and
WHEREAS, this public hearing was continued to the regular City Council
meeting held Monday, June 28, 1999; and
WHEREAS, following these two public hearings on the Fiscal Year 1999-00
City of Rolling Hills Draft Budget, members of the Rolling Hills City Council desire to
adopt said document.
N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ED BY MEMBERS OF THE ROLLING
HILLS CITY COUNCIL AS FOLLOWS:
Section 1. Members of the City Council hereby adopt the Fiscal Year 1999-00
City of Rolling Hills Budget.
Section 2. The Mayor is hereby directed to sign this Resolution, and the
City Clerk, or duly authorize Deputy, is directed to attest thereto.
